  • OPEC+ announces 2 million-barrel production cut

    10/05/2022 7:27:30 AM PDT · by Erik Latranyi · 127 replies
    The Hill ^ | 5 Oct 22 | Zack Budryk
    The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) and its oil-exporting allies announced a 2 million barrel per day cut in oil production Wednesday, bucking months of pressure from Washington to increase production and potentially spiking gas prices again. The coalition, which includes the 13 OPEC nations and 11 non-members including Russia, made the announcement at its Vienna meeting, the first in-person summit since the beginning of the COVID-19 pandemic. The announced cut is roughly equivalent to 2 percent of global supplies. In July, President Biden visited Saudi Arabia to directly appeal to its leaders to increase oil production, despite...

  • More Americans now say Russia is winning the war than say Ukraine is

    06/19/2022 7:22:19 PM PDT · by BusterDog · 61 replies
    YouGov ^ | 6/15/22
    Data from the latest Economist/YouGov poll finds that Americans have grown more pessimistic when it comes to Ukraine’s path to victory. This week's was the first survey since we began asking who is winning the war — about a month after it began — in which more Americans say that Russia is winning (25%) than say Ukraine is (19%). In recent weeks the share who say neither side is winning also has increased, to 38%.
